One of the key events organised by the Division’s EDI Associates this term. This event showcases various initiatives that have taken place to engage with decolonising and diversifying the curricula, and creating inclusive classrooms, at Social Science departments within the University. Divisional EDI Associates will talk about the lessons that can be learned from across a range of departments. The aim of the event is to encourage knowledge exchange between the departments with a view on progressing the EDI commitments of the University through engaging in decolonising and diversifying curriculum debates meaningfully, and creating a collaborative and inclusive academic and learning culture.
This hybrid event is aimed at anyone involved in teaching and designing curricula, or with an interest in these areas.
